Case of Nicolae Nogai sent to court

The legal case opened against the Bender Court of Appeals judge Nicolae Nogai, who is accused of illegally authorizing the sale of shares in BC Moldova-Agroindbank SA, was remitted to court, Info-Prim Neo reports. According to a communiqué from the Prosecutor General’s Office, the judge is accused of passing an illegal decision that had serious consequences. He faces 3 to 7 years in jail and may be banned from holding certain posts or performing certain activities for a period of up to five years. The case was sent to the Causeni Court for examination, in accordance with the local jurisdiction. But the prosecutors intend to demand transferring the case to a similar court in Chisinau municipality so as to ensure the objective and swift examination of the case. Earlier this year, Nicolae Nogai was suspended from post by the Supreme Council of Magistrates, at the request of Prosecutor General Valeriu Zubko.
